Can I take Klabax with Elicea?
19.99 zł

Hello. I am taking Elicea medicine for anxiety neurosis yesterday it turned out that I have anigine I was prescribed klabax the doctor knows about Elicea can I take this antibiotic normally? Another antibiotic does not work on angina, I did a throat swab.

Elicea (escitalopram) can be used in combination with the antibiotic Klabax (clarithromycin) if it has been prescribed by the same doctor, or if the doctor prescribing this preparation has been told what other medicines you are already taking and what additional medical conditions you are suffering from. Combining these medicines increases the risk of serious side effects, such as arrhythmias. Therefore, if combining these drugs is necessary, you should strictly follow the dosage regimen established with your doctor.
